Instant Pot Chicken Bruschetta

Yields: 4 servings

Ingredients:

  • 4 to 5 large skinless, boneless chicken breasts
  • 2  minced garlic cloves
  • 1/2 cup balsamic v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 14 1/2 ounce can diced or chopped tomatoes
  • 1 tsp worcestershire sauce
  • 1/3 cup sherry or white grape juice, apple juice, water, or a mixture of water and juice
  • 1/2 tsp coarse sea or kosher salt
  • 1/2 tsp pepper
  • 2 tsp Italian seasoning

Directions:

  1. Combine the diced tomatoes, sherry or juice, Worcestershire sauce, balsamic vinegar, Italian seasoning, salt and pepper into a mixing bowl.
  2. Select saute on your Instant Pot and add the olive oil to the pot. Brown chicken in two batches on both sides.
  3. Remove chicken from pot and add garlic to the pot. Cook, stirring until soft, about 2-3 minutes.
  4. Return the chicken to the pot.
  5. Pour the tomato mixture over chicken.
  6. Cook at high pressure for 8 minutes. When cooking is complete, use a natural release to depressurize. That’s it!
  7. Serve over rice or noodles.
